Ver Mensaje Individual
  #2 (permalink)  
Antiguo 06/11/2007, 17:32
Shantic
 
Fecha de Ingreso: julio-2004
Ubicación: Puerto Vallarta, Jalisco, Mexico
Mensajes: 186
Antigüedad: 20 años, 7 meses
Puntos: 0
Re: Problema con fechas debido a zona horaria

Cita:
Iniciado por ZydRick Ver Mensaje
Buenas, he programado un sistema de noticias y la fecha en MySQL la tengo como tipo DATETIME, pues bien, yo vivo en Perú y mi web la tengo alojada en un servidor en España, de modo que, si publico una noticia hoy 06/11 a las 06:00pm(Hora Perú) la fecha se guarda como 07/11 a las 00:00 horas, debido a que son 6 horas de diferencia entre España y Perú, mi pregunta es. ¿Existe alguna manera de arreglar eso?, lo necesito porque los demás scripts que tengo como el de cumpleaños que consulté hace un momento también caería en ese lío.

Se agradece la ayuda.

Saludos.
usa el putenv TZ para modificar la zona horaria

<?
echo "Original Time: ". date("h:i:s")."\n";
putenv("TZ=US/Eastern");
echo "New Time: ". date("h:i:s")."\n";
?>

puedes leer mas aqui:
hxxp://www.modwest.com/help/kb5-258.html

y una lista de zonas horarias aqui:
hxxp://www.theprojects.org/dev/zone.txt

Saludos :)
__________________
Shanti Castillo G.